Spiritualized – All Of My Tears Lyrics 18 years ago
Very beautiful. Originally a Spacemen 3 song, Jason Pierce redid it with his next band, changing the lead guitar with violin as well as giving it a good kick of ambience. I recommend you hear the original if you haven't--they're equally amazing. The lyrics provided on this site contain a couple of errors: one semantic, another apparently a mishearing. The final word of the song is 'babe', not 'shame'. Sort of changes the conclusion of the song a bit, yes?

Water is a symbol of purity/healing that Pierce uses often in his lyrics (see: Cool Waves, Lord Let It Rain On Me, On Fire, I Didn't Mean to Hurt You, etc.). I don't think he uses 'Lord' as anymore than a vain cry for something higher than himself to help him. Perhaps alluding to a secular Job-like character? In this case, he's apparently in despair and the only thing he needs is something to bring him back to a peaceful state--which isn't so easy considering his circumstance (see: Home of the Brave, Cop Shoot Cop, Lord Help Me Out, etc.). He's apparently hurting for love. Not only an endless river, but an ocean as well? Pretty powerful statement.

I believe Jason Pierce to be a true master of minimalism. This song epitomizes this.
